Chimney Cottage is a charming, thatched, self catering holiday cottage which sleeps up to six guests (five adults, plus child, plus cot) in the delightful, historic village of Dunster. This spacious, grade II listed holiday cottage, dates back to the 17th century and is located in a lovely position near the old Mill. The cottage has a south-facing courtyard garden which slopes down to the stream that feeds the Mill (a stone wall with a solid gate ensures safety for children). Fernhill Cottage is located in the pretty village of Ponsworthy in the heart of Dartmoor and offers a fantastic base to enjoy rural peace and tranquillity. It is ideally placed for walking, pony trekking, cycling and other moorland activities and comes with a concierge service supplying local information and organisation of a whole host of activities including farm visits, fishing, llama walks, abseiling, golf and hot air ballooning.
For something more leisurely, the area offers heritage sites and National Trust properties, along with farms and miniature pony sanctuaries. Across the moor, there are pubs, restaurants and cafés where you can sample a famous Devon cream tea and there are a rich variety of shops selling local produce, arts and crafts.
